Welcome to the Fennel platform team. Your first task is assisting with the leaked-file-descriptor hunt in the Ortolan ingest daemon. We suspect descriptors escape during retry storms; the tracer service records open handles per process. To query the tracer's descriptor snapshots, authenticate against the Pinwheel internal API using the key below.

gateway credential: kto3_qfe

## 2.8.1 — Key rotation

Flagpost rollout framework: rotated artifact signing credentials after scheduled 90-day expiry. Old key revoked and removed from the Tessary build agents. All flag-evaluation bundles published since Tuesday are signed with the new credential. No compromise suspected; routine rotation. Verify downstream mirrors re-fetch the trust bundle. The replacement signing key is as follows.

rollout seal: bky4_x7Gc

## Environment Variables — Ledgerpane Audit Viewer

Ledgerpane reads its configuration exclusively from the environment at startup; nothing is cached to disk. `LP_LOG_BUCKET` and `LP_RETENTION_DAYS` are non-sensitive and checked into the sample file. Access to the immutable audit store, however, requires a signing credential that must never appear in version control. When provisioning a reviewer instance, append that credential to your local env file immediately after this line.

vault entry, yahif-yajep: COURIER_KEY29=b802bdf8034096b65a51c6ba5abe2